How do I get to Nepal?
The 1st question of the travelers about Nepal FAQ. It is really easy to travel to Nepal. You may find the best deals with the travel agents. They will help you organize the trip. Independent traveling is also an option. But it is always convenient and safe to travel with a trusted travel companion.
You can find the Airlines from your origin place to Nepal. Currently, as on the date of July 2019, there is only one international airport in Nepal. Tribhuvan International Airport acts as the central hub of Air transfers in Nepal.
There are a lot of domestic airlines, serving guests with the finest airline experience. Also, it is safe to visit Nepal. You are coming via ground way, there are 6 major entry points to enter Nepal.
India lies in the East, West and Southern part of Nepal whereas China lies in the northern part of Nepal. The six major entry points lie in Kakarbhitta, Biratnagar, Birgunj, Bhairahawa, Nepalgunj, and Mahendranagar of Nepal in the Nepal-India border. So, it is easy to travel to Nepal. Also, you can get an arrival visa in Nepal.
Do I have to apply Nepal visa in advance?
It’s not necessary to get a visa before traveling in Nepal. However, you can apply for a visa online from the immigration department. Also, you can easily get an arrival visa in Nepal. The single entry visa for 15 days, 30 days and 90 days is available and costs the US $25, $40 and $100 respectively. For Indian nationals, a visa is not applicable. SAARC countries nationals can get a 30 days visa for free in Nepal. For more information, visit the Nepal immigration centre’s website.
What are the health concerns in Nepal?
Trekking in the Himalayan region is a little difficult for beginners. Altitude mountain sickness is a major problem for trekkers. However, for that we have certified and licensed guides with first aid knowledge and medications can be used to avoid AMS. Other health concerns include Drinking water and food.
It is best avoided to eat and drink water everywhere. The mineral water is safe and there are so many restaurants with good food facilities. Eating in the street, however, is not preferred. And personal medications can be used, if necessary.

Can we smoke in Bhutan?
You cannot smoke everywhere in Bhutan. The sale and exchange of tobacco products are prohibited in this Himalayan Kingdom. However, you can get a cigarette at duty-free. Also, you have to pay duty for the smoking products.
